Output 7e31693c849865feab81f9df211163064bf8a6d4c525d5a3b18af2cff207134f:1

value
2158890810
script pubkey
OP_0 OP_PUSHBYTES_20 6abba1427ab40d705e3b7cabe5659508cd6e6145
address
tb1qd2a6zsn6ksxhqh3m0j472ev4prxkuc2986deay
transaction
7e31693c849865feab81f9df211163064bf8a6d4c525d5a3b18af2cff207134f